Resources featuring creatures, often mammals or birds, designed for the application of color are readily available in both digital and physical formats. These outlines offer a structured artistic activity suitable for various age groups. Examples range from simple outlines for young children to complex, detailed illustrations for older children and adults.

The practice of coloring such illustrations supports the development of fine motor skills, encourages creative expression, and can provide a relaxing and focused activity. Historically, similar artistic endeavors have been used as educational tools and recreational pastimes, contributing to both artistic skill and cognitive development. Frequently Asked Questions Regarding Animal-Themed Coloring Illustrations

This section addresses common inquiries concerning illustrations depicting fauna intended for coloring, providing clarity and detailed information.

Question 1: What age groups benefit most from using coloring pages featuring animals?

While individuals of all ages may engage with coloring activities, younger children particularly benefit from the development of fine motor skills and color recognition. Older children and adults may find them a relaxing and creative outlet.

Question 2: Are there specific educational advantages to using illustrations of animals designed for coloring?

Yes. These illustrations can facilitate learning about different species, their habitats, and their characteristics. The act of coloring reinforces visual memory and attention to detail.

Question 3: Where can one locate readily accessible illustrations of animals for coloring?

Numerous online resources offer printable or downloadable illustrations. Additionally, physical books containing these images are available at most bookstores and educational supply stores.

Question 4: What materials are best suited for coloring animal-themed illustrations?

Common coloring materials include crayons, colored pencils, markers, and paint. The choice of medium depends on the desired effect, the paper quality, and the user’s personal preference.

Question 5: Are there potential therapeutic benefits to coloring these types of illustrations?

Engaging in coloring activities can promote relaxation, reduce stress, and improve focus. It can serve as a form of art therapy and mindfulness practice.

Question 6: What distinguishes a high-quality illustration from a low-quality one intended for coloring?

High-quality illustrations exhibit clear lines, well-defined shapes, and sufficient detail to allow for creative expression. Low-quality illustrations may have blurry lines, disproportionate features, or insufficient detail.

Tips for Maximizing the Benefits of Animal-Themed Coloring Illustrations

Engaging with illustrations of fauna intended for coloring can be enhanced through careful consideration of materials, techniques, and educational opportunities. The following guidelines provide insights into optimizing the experience.

Tip 1: Select Illustrations Aligned with Skill Level. The complexity of the outline should match the colorist’s ability to prevent frustration or boredom. Simpler designs are suitable for beginners, while intricate illustrations are appropriate for more experienced individuals.

Tip 2: Prioritize High-Quality Printing or Materials. If using printable resources, opt for high-resolution downloads and print on thicker paper to prevent bleed-through. Commercial coloring books generally offer higher paper quality.

Tip 3: Employ a Variety of Coloring Mediums. Experiment with colored pencils, markers, crayons, and watercolors to explore different textures and effects. Understanding the properties of each medium will improve the overall result.

Tip 4: Incorporate Educational Elements. Research the specific animal being colored to learn about its habitat, diet, and unique characteristics. This integrates learning with artistic expression.

Tip 5: Consider Color Theory. Understanding basic color relationships, such as complementary or analogous color schemes, can enhance the visual appeal of the completed illustration.

Tip 6: Focus on Detail and Precision. Encourage patience and attention to detail, particularly in complex illustrations. This promotes fine motor skill development and focus.

Tip 7: Utilize Shading Techniques. Employ shading techniques to add depth and dimension to the illustration. Varying pressure when using colored pencils or layering colors can create realistic effects.

By implementing these tips, individuals can maximize the artistic, educational, and therapeutic benefits derived from engaging with these illustrations.
